Tentative ruling: Ex parte application to extend time to file
Motion to Tax Costs
GRANTED for a period of not more than 30 days
from the date it is due. Good cause is
shown because plaintiff’s counsel is currently in a position of a possible
conflict of interest.
Good cause is shown to allow him to withdraw
and to give his clients time to either file the motion on their own or obtain
new counsel.
Absent the
parties' stipulation, the court may extend the deadline for up to 30 days. [CRC
3.1700(b)(3); Adam v. DeCharon (1995) 31 CA4th 708, 713, 37 CR2d 195, 197]
